Ingredients for All In One Broccoli Macaroni And Cheese
- Skim Milk
- 1 cup water
- Macaroni And Cheese Mix
- Frozen Broccoli
- 1 tablespoon butter
- Salt And Pepper
- Cheddar Cheese
How to Make All In One Broccoli Macaroni And Cheese
- In a medium saucepan, bring 1 cup of water and 1/2 cup of milk to a gentle simmer over medium heat.
- Add 1 cup of elbow macaroni, reduce heat to low, and simmer for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Stir in 1 cup of frozen broccoli florets (thawed). Cover the saucepan and simmer for another 3-4 minutes, or until the macaroni is cooked through and the broccoli is tender-crisp.
- Remove from heat and stir in 1/2 cup of cheese sauce mix (according to package directions) and 1 tablespoon of butter until completely melted and smooth.
- Season generously with salt and pepper to taste.
- If desired, stir in 1/4 cup of grated cheddar or Italian blend cheese until melted and creamy.
- Serve immediately and enjoy!
